Kyuss

Kyuss formed in Palm Desert, California in 1987 and invented the desert rock sound playing generator parties in the open desert, powering their equipment off gasoline generators with no PA system. Josh Homme ran his guitar through bass amplifiers to fill the low-frequency void left by the lack of reinforcement. Blues for the Red Sun and Welcome to Sky Valley are the foundational texts of the genre. The band dissolved in 1995 and directly spawned Queens of the Stone Age, Fu Manchu, Mondo Generator, and dozens of others.
